A system and method for coating implantable medical devices so that they do not interfere with MR imaging are described. Using any of the coating processes well known to those skilled in the art, e.g., physical vapor deposition such as evaporation, sputtering, or cathode arc, or chemical vapor deposition, spraying, plasma polymerization, plasma enhanced chemical vapor deposition and the like, multiple sources, including at least one source of an electrically insulating material and at least one source of an electrically conducting material, are oriented and shielded so as to coat separate sections of the implantable medical device. The object being coated is then rotated so that overlapping spiral coatings of the materials from the different coating sources are produced on the object.
